Fresh Content: Why Publish Dates Make or Break Rankings and AI Visibility

Optimixed’s Overview: How Maintaining Updated Content Drives SEO Success and AI Recognition

Why Content Freshness Matters

Search engines and AI assistants increasingly prioritize recently updated content. Google’s Query Deserves Freshness (QDF) algorithm boosts pages that provide timely information, especially for trending topics or queries explicitly seeking new data (e.g., “latest news” or “2025 trends”). Fresh content improves click-through rates, preventing ranking declines caused by user perception of outdated information.

Types of Content That Require Frequent Updates

  • Time-sensitive topics: Election results, stock market updates, or breaking news require immediate refreshes.
  • Seasonal and event-driven content: Black Friday deals, tax deadlines, and travel guides need updates ahead of peak interest periods.
  • Product reviews and software comparisons: Annual or quarterly updates ensure relevance as new models and features emerge.
  • Technology, regulations, and industry trends: Regular monitoring is essential due to constant changes.

Tools and Strategies for Systematic Content Refresh

Optimize your update process by using tools such as Ahrefs Webmaster Tools and Screaming Frog to identify outdated pages via publish and modified date metadata. Implement regex filters to find content that has never been updated or was last refreshed before a specific date.

For automation, leveraging APIs (e.g., Ahrefs API) combined with custom scripts can help detect traffic gaps and prioritize updates based on search volume and current organic traffic. Incorporate AI helpers to uncover content gaps, topical expansions, and missing questions to improve comprehensiveness.

Best Practices for Effective Content Updates

  • Replace old statistics with current data and add “as of [Month Year]” notes to key facts.
  • Update pricing, screenshots, and product/service availability.
  • Highlight recent developments and new objections in your niche.
  • Make update dates visible to users and search engines by changing titles, schema markup, and adding update notes.
  • Strengthen internal linking during refreshes to distribute authority and improve user navigation.
  • Promote refreshed content through social media, paid ads, and repurposing formats like webinars to attract backlinks and new visitors.

Measuring and Maintaining Content Freshness

Track improvements by monitoring keyword rankings and click-through rates via tools like Google Search Console and Ahrefs Rank Tracker. Compare your update frequency against competitors to ensure you remain competitive. Avoid common pitfalls such as making only superficial changes or neglecting fundamental SEO elements while focusing on freshness.

Conclusion

Consistent, substantial content updates create a compounding advantage—improving rankings, increasing traffic, earning more AI citations, and attracting fresh backlinks. Balancing content freshness with new content creation is key to sustained SEO success and maintaining strong visibility in evolving search landscapes.
